Chuyển đổi TSV sang XLS bằng GroupDocs.Conversion cho .NET
Giới thiệu
Bạn có muốn chuyển đổi hiệu quả các tệp Tab Separated Values (TSV) sang định dạng XLS của Excel không? Cho dù là để phân tích dữ liệu hay tạo báo cáo, việc chuyển đổi các loại tệp này là điều cần thiết. Hướng dẫn từng bước này sẽ hướng dẫn bạn cách sử dụng GroupDocs.Conversion cho .NET để thực hiện chuyển đổi này một cách liền mạch.
Trong hướng dẫn chi tiết này, chúng ta sẽ khám phá cách GroupDocs.Conversion đơn giản hóa việc xử lý tài liệu trong các ứng dụng .NET của bạn. Bạn sẽ tìm hiểu về:
- Lợi ích của việc chuyển đổi TSV sang XLS
- Thiết lập và sử dụng GroupDocs.Conversion cho .NET
- Thực hiện chuyển đổi với các bước rõ ràng và ví dụ mã
Bạn đã sẵn sàng để hợp lý hóa quá trình chuyển đổi dữ liệu chưa? Hãy bắt đầu bằng cách tìm hiểu các điều kiện tiên quyết.
Điều kiện tiên quyết
Trước khi bắt đầu, hãy đảm bảo rằng bạn có:
- Thư viện: Tải xuống và cài đặt GroupDocs.Conversion cho .NET (khuyến nghị phiên bản 25.3.0).
- Thiết lập môi trường: Môi trường phát triển .NET được cấu hình (khuyến khích sử dụng Visual Studio).
- Kiến thức: Hiểu biết cơ bản về lập trình C# và các hoạt động I/O tệp.
Thiết lập GroupDocs.Conversion cho .NET
Cài đặt
Cài đặt GroupDocs.Conversion bằng NuGet Package Manager Console hoặc .NET CLI:
Bảng điều khiển quản lý gói NuGet
Install-Package GroupDocs.Conversion -Version 25.3.0
.NETCLI
dotnet add package GroupDocs.Conversion --version 25.3.0
Mua lại giấy phép
Để bắt đầu, hãy tải bản dùng thử miễn phí hoặc giấy phép tạm thời để khám phá các tính năng của GroupDocs.Conversion. Truy cập Mua GroupDocs cho các tùy chọn và Giấy phép tạm thời nếu cần thiết.
Khởi tạo
Khởi tạo bộ chuyển đổi bằng tệp nguồn của bạn:
using GroupDocs.Conversion;
// Khởi tạo đối tượng Converter bằng tệp TSV nguồn của bạn.
var converter = new Converter("sample.tsv");
Hướng dẫn thực hiện
Chúng ta hãy chia nhỏ quá trình chuyển đổi thành các bước rõ ràng.
Tải và Chuẩn bị Tệp TSV của Bạn
Chỉ định đường dẫn cho các tệp đầu vào và đầu ra. Đảm bảo tệp TSV hợp lệ đã sẵn sàng:
string dataDirectory = "YOUR_DOCUMENT_DIRECTORY";
string outputDirectory = "YOUR_OUTPUT_DIRECTORY";
string inputFile = Path.Combine(dataDirectory, "sample.tsv");
string outputFile = Path.Combine(outputDirectory, "tsv-converted-to.xls");
Chuyển đổi TSV sang XLS
Thiết lập tùy chọn chuyển đổi cho định dạng mục tiêu:
using (var converter = new Converter(inputFile))
{
// Xác định cài đặt chuyển đổi cho Excel.
var options = new SpreadsheetConvertOptions { Format = SpreadsheetFileType.Xls };
// Thực hiện quá trình chuyển đổi.
converter.Convert(outputFile, options);
}
Trong đoạn mã này:
SpreadsheetConvertOptions
chỉ định định dạng và bất kỳ tham số bổ sung nào.- Các
Format
thuộc tính được thiết lập thànhXls
, cho biết định dạng đầu ra mong muốn.
Mẹo khắc phục sự cố
Các vấn đề thường gặp bao gồm đường dẫn tệp không đúng hoặc thiếu sự phụ thuộc. Đảm bảo thư mục của bạn tồn tại và tất cả các gói được cài đặt đúng cách.
Ứng dụng thực tế
GroupDocs.Conversion for .NET cung cấp tính linh hoạt vượt xa việc chỉ chuyển đổi tệp:
- Báo cáo dữ liệu: Tự động chuyển đổi dữ liệu thô thành các báo cáo có cấu trúc.
- Hệ thống CRM: Tích hợp liền mạch việc chuyển đổi tài liệu trong các công cụ CRM.
- Phân tích tài chính: Chuyển đổi bảng tính tài chính giữa các định dạng để phân tích và báo cáo.
Cân nhắc về hiệu suất
Để tối ưu hóa hiệu suất khi sử dụng GroupDocs.Conversion:
- Giảm thiểu việc sử dụng bộ nhớ bằng cách xử lý các tệp lớn thành nhiều phần nếu có thể.
- Sử dụng các phương pháp không đồng bộ để ngăn chặn các hoạt động chặn.
- Tạo hồ sơ cho ứng dụng của bạn để xác định những điểm nghẽn trong quá trình chuyển đổi.
Phần kết luận
Bằng cách làm theo hướng dẫn này, giờ đây bạn đã có kiến thức để chuyển đổi tệp TSV sang định dạng XLS bằng GroupDocs.Conversion cho .NET. Bạn đã học cách thiết lập môi trường, triển khai chuyển đổi tệp và áp dụng các biện pháp thực hành tốt nhất để tối ưu hóa hiệu suất.
Các bước tiếp theo
Khám phá các tính năng khác của GroupDocs.Conversion như khả năng xem trước tài liệu hoặc chuyển đổi giữa các định dạng (PDF, DOCX) để nâng cao chức năng của ứng dụng.
Phần Câu hỏi thường gặp
Câu hỏi 1: Sự khác biệt giữa XLS và XLSX là gì? A1: XLS là định dạng Excel cũ sử dụng tệp nhị phân, trong khi XLSX sử dụng nén tệp dựa trên XML để có hiệu suất và tính năng tốt hơn.
Câu hỏi 2: Tôi có thể chuyển đổi TSV sang các định dạng khác ngoài XLS không? A2: Có, GroupDocs.Conversion hỗ trợ nhiều định dạng đầu ra như PDF, DOCX, CSV, v.v.
Câu hỏi 3: Tôi phải xử lý các tập tin lớn như thế nào trong quá trình chuyển đổi? A3: Cân nhắc xử lý tệp thành nhiều phần nhỏ hơn hoặc tối ưu hóa việc sử dụng bộ nhớ của ứng dụng để có hiệu suất tốt hơn.
Câu hỏi 4: Giấy phép dùng thử miễn phí có những hạn chế gì? A4: Bản dùng thử miễn phí thường có những hạn chế về tính năng như hình mờ trên tài liệu đầu ra. Kiểm tra trang cấp phép của GroupDocs để biết chi tiết.
Câu hỏi 5: Tôi có được hỗ trợ nếu gặp vấn đề khi chuyển đổi không? A5: Có, bạn có thể tìm kiếm sự giúp đỡ từ Diễn đàn hỗ trợ GroupDocs.
Tài nguyên
- Tài liệu: https://docs.groupdocs.com/conversion/net/
- Tài liệu tham khảo API: https://reference.groupdocs.com/conversion/net/
- Tải xuống GroupDocs.Conversion: https://releases.groupdocs.com/conversion/net/
- Mua GroupDocs: https://purchase.groupdocs.com/buy
- Dùng thử miễn phí và Giấy phép tạm thời: https://releases.groupdocs.com/conversion/net/ | Giấy phép tạm thời
- Diễn đàn hỗ trợ: https://forum.groupdocs.com/c/conversion/10
Bằng cách sử dụng GroupDocs.Conversion cho .NET, bạn đã mở khóa một công cụ mạnh mẽ để nâng cao khả năng quản lý tài liệu của mình. Chúc bạn chuyển đổi vui vẻ!